"So... what's going on with the shop?" The short answer is, we are changing things up! The Market Arcade is going to look a little difference (a lot different!) in the new normal, but we are rolling with it and doing some new things! Everything will basically stay the same for our weddings clients, but all of our retail is going to move online, AND we are releasing a new line of stationery and gifts! The long answer is up on our blog! Thanks to everyone who has hung out with us on this awesome adventure, we can't wait to show you what we're working on next!
